%T Understanding the lived experience and benefits of regional cities %A Laura Crommelin %A Todd Denham %A Laurence Troy %A et al. %I Australian Housing and Urban Research Institute %D 2022 %K Population growth, %K Regional planning, %K Urban planning, %K Population, %K Public opinion, %K Lived experience %R 10.18408/ahuri7126301 %U https://apo.org.au/node/317676 %X This research investigates the lived experience of regional city residents (in five case studies) to understand how the benefits and disadvantages of regional city life are perceived and explore attitudes towards population growth. %9 Report
